Investors Are Hunting for Countercyclical Value in Privacy Coins

– By Carter Feldman, CEO and founder, Psy Protocol

The sustained pressure of a bitcoin price decline acts not only as a system-wide depressant, but also as a catalyst for efficiency, forcing both miners and investors to seek value in specialized plays. The bear market makes this a prime moment for ZK proof-of-work privacy coins, whose security and logarithmic scalability now matter more than ever for miners and private agentic-internet transactions.

When bitcoin’s price stagnates, miner margins compress. This economic reality forces miners to become more shrewd as capital allocators, shifting hash power toward more profitable, specialized chains. This is a calculated move toward protocols that reward not just raw energy expenditure, but provide utility that the market desires.

This is where privacy coins enter the conversation. While the broader market consolidated, there was a privacy coin surge spearheaded by Zcash ZEC$401.94, encrypted electronic cash used for private, everyday payments. With price increases of up to 950% from September lows, it far outpaced general market performance. This resurgence is a signal that both retail and institutional actors recognize privacy as a missing piece in the maturing crypto ecosystem.

The adoption metrics confirm this. Zcash’s shielded pool (i.e., tokens held in private addresses) recently hit its highest-ever level of over 4.5 million tokens, signaling growing user demand for true financial autonomy. The market is not just speculating; it is functionally demanding a system that offers accountability without sacrificing confidentiality.

The technology underpinning this privacy, known as zero-knowledge (ZK) proofs, is the real long-term institutional draw, reaching far beyond the crypto world. ZK is fundamentally a computational tool that allows one party to prove a statement is true without revealing the underlying data.

This capability is rapidly moving into real-world applications where data protection is paramount:

  • Decentralized identity: Proving you are over 18 without revealing your birthdate or name, crucial for regulatory compliance (GDPR, etc.).
  • Supply chain: Verifying the ethical sourcing or origin of a product without revealing sensitive supplier contracts or business relationships.
  • Secure voting: Allowing participants to prove their eligibility to vote without revealing their identity or ballot choice.

In this context, ZK-native protocols are merely adapting this universal technology to the hardest, highest-stakes computational problem: internet-scale financial transactions. By performing transaction verification client-side, ZK can scale while retaining the privacy that is becoming the global standard for data security across all industries. This dual utility is why ZK-native assets are a shrewd long-term investment; they are built on a technology that is quickly becoming mandatory, not just optional, for global digital infrastructure.

While the market fretted about bitcoin price fluctuations, smart investors recognized privacy coins met a real market demand.

Vibe Check

Smooth the Ride, Part II: ETH’s whirlwind year has not been for the faint of heart.

– By Andy Baehr, CFA, head of product and research, CoinDesk Indices

A few weeks ago, we showed how a trend overlay on bitcoin helped salvage 2025 returns. Our Bitcoin Trend Indicator (BTI) signaled the coming “Significant Downtrend” in mid-October, allowing strategies to step aside and preserve capital. For advisors and institutions building long-term crypto allocations, we noted that trend-informed strategies can help “smooth the ride” and keep folks in the game.

In last week’s Crypto Long & Short, we reiterated the view that there can be no broad digital asset class rally without ETH participating–if not leading. Like it or not, Ethereum is the standard bearer for blockchain adoption narratives. It is–in the eyes of many–not an “altcoin.” When ETH rallies, it signals something larger is afoot:that stablecoins, DeFi, and tokenization are gaining mindshare in the global consciousness. We noted that the Fusaka upgrade is an embodiment of the kind of progress, focus, and yes – messaging that will foster even greater mindshare.

Still, ETH has been quite a handful in 2025, making conviction–and sizing–a challenge.

The case for Ether trend

This brings us to a natural question: how does our trend strategy work on ETH? We launched the Ether Trend Indicator (ETI) alongside BTI back in March 2023, using the same quartet of moving average crossover signals. We tested those signals on both assets, liked what we saw, and have not had need to alter them since.

ETH price color-coded by Ether Trend Indicator (greens are uptrend, yellow neutral, reds downtrend)

Source: CoinDesk Indices

If you think about why time series momentum should work–new information prompts different segments of the market over time–then ETH seems like a good candidate. Hedge funds and crypto-native derivatives traders are more likely to start a trend. ETF flows are more likely to follow.

ETH has had three prominent phases in 2025: A Q1 breakdown, a Q2-Q3 powerhouse rally, and the heartbreaking Q4 drawdown. We applied a systematic trend strategy (live since Oct 2023) following ETI to ETH and the results are startling.

ETH trend strategy (live since Oct 2023) helped smooth the ride

Source: CoinDesk Indices. “ETIS1” strategy. Methodology here. Hypothetical results ignoring transactions costs. Past performance is no guarantee of future results.

ETI has shown ETH to be in Downtrend for 5 days and in Significant Downtrend for the previous 29. For a marketplace numb from calling bottoms, maybe it’s just better to follow the signals and wait for the trend to reverse.


Chart of the Week

ETH DAT Flows vs. ETH Price

In this week’s COTW we look at Ethereum Digital Asset Treasury (DAT) flows and the ETH price, revealing a clear correlation: the trend in DAT flows appears to be a core price driver. Before October 2025, rising DAT flows strongly corresponded with the ETH price rally. Since the price of ETH peaked around October 2025, both flows and price have been on a downtrend. Given that these DATs hold approximately 3.5% of the circulating ETH supply, the current lack of upward momentum in these flows suggests that a renewed and clear uptrend in DAT accumulation is likely a prerequisite for the next major upward price movement.

The post The Channel Factories We’ve Been Waiting For appeared on BitcoinEthereumNews.com. Visions of future technology are often prescient about the broad strokes while flubbing the details. The tablets in “2001: A Space Odyssey” do indeed look like iPads, but you never see the astronauts paying for subscriptions or wasting hours on Candy Crush.  Channel factories are one vision that arose early in the history of the Lightning Network to address some challenges that Lightning has faced from the beginning. Despite having grown to become Bitcoin’s most successful layer-2 scaling solution, with instant and low-fee payments, Lightning’s scale is limited by its reliance on payment channels. Although Lightning shifts most transactions off-chain, each payment channel still requires an on-chain transaction to open and (usually) another to close. As adoption grows, pressure on the blockchain grows with it. The need for a more scalable approach to managing channels is clear. Channel factories were supposed to meet this need, but where are they? In 2025, subnetworks are emerging that revive the impetus of channel factories with some new details that vastly increase their potential. They are natively interoperable with Lightning and achieve greater scale by allowing a group of participants to open a shared multisig UTXO and create multiple bilateral channels, which reduces the number of on-chain transactions and improves capital efficiency. Achieving greater scale by reducing complexity, Ark and Spark perform the same function as traditional channel factories with new designs and additional capabilities based on shared UTXOs.  Channel Factories 101 Channel factories have been around since the inception of Lightning. A factory is a multiparty contract where multiple users (not just two, as in a Dryja-Poon channel) cooperatively lock funds in a single multisig UTXO. They can open, close and update channels off-chain without updating the blockchain for each operation. Only when participants leave or the factory dissolves is an on-chain transaction…

BitcoinWorld Crucial Fed Rate Cut: October Probability Surges to 94% The financial world is buzzing with a significant development: the probability of a Fed rate cut in October has just seen a dramatic increase. This isn’t just a minor shift; it’s a monumental change that could ripple through global markets, including the dynamic cryptocurrency space. For anyone tracking economic indicators and their impact on investments, this update from the U.S. interest rate futures market is absolutely crucial. What Just Happened? Unpacking the FOMC Statement’s Impact Following the latest Federal Open Market Committee (FOMC) statement, market sentiment has decisively shifted. Before the announcement, the U.S. interest rate futures market had priced in a 71.6% chance of an October rate cut. However, after the statement, this figure surged to an astounding 94%. This jump indicates that traders and analysts are now overwhelmingly confident that the Federal Reserve will lower interest rates next month. Such a high probability suggests a strong consensus emerging from the Fed’s latest communications and economic outlook. A Fed rate cut typically means cheaper borrowing costs for businesses and consumers, which can stimulate economic activity. But what does this really signify for investors, especially those in the digital asset realm? Why is a Fed Rate Cut So Significant for Markets? When the Federal Reserve adjusts interest rates, it sends powerful signals across the entire financial ecosystem. A rate cut generally implies a more accommodative monetary policy, often enacted to boost economic growth or combat deflationary pressures. Impact on Traditional Markets: Stocks: Lower interest rates can make borrowing cheaper for companies, potentially boosting earnings and making stocks more attractive compared to bonds. Bonds: Existing bonds with higher yields might become more valuable, but new bonds will likely offer lower returns. Dollar Strength: A rate cut can weaken the U.S. dollar, making exports cheaper and potentially benefiting multinational corporations. Potential for Cryptocurrency Markets: The cryptocurrency market, while often seen as uncorrelated, can still react significantly to macro-economic shifts. A Fed rate cut could be interpreted as: Increased Risk Appetite: With traditional investments offering lower returns, investors might seek higher-yielding or more volatile assets like cryptocurrencies. Inflation Hedge Narrative: If rate cuts are perceived as a precursor to inflation, assets like Bitcoin, often dubbed “digital gold,” could gain traction as an inflation hedge. Liquidity Influx: A more accommodative monetary environment generally means more liquidity in the financial system, some of which could flow into digital assets.
